What Type of Antibiotic is Ancefa (Cefadroxil)?

Ancefa is a prescription-only medicine containing the active component Cefadroxil. This drug is definitively classified within the pharmacological class of first-generation cephalosporins, a specific type of semisynthetic beta-lactam antibiotic used for systemic administration. The clinical utility of Cefadroxil is well-supported by pharmacological studies, which recognize its distinct effectiveness profile against susceptible bacterial organisms, such as those causing skin or urinary tract infections. It is a single-ingredient product, confirming that its action is derived solely from the Cefadroxil compound.


Composition, Origin, and Available Forms

The therapeutic action is derived entirely from the active ingredient Cefadroxil, which is typically manufactured and supplied as the monohydrate salt. The semisynthetic origin means the compound is a chemically modified derivative, developed to enhance stability and absorption compared to purely natural antibiotics. For patient use, the drug is available for oral administration in multiple drug forms suitable for different needs, including capsules, tablets, and a powder for oral suspension for liquid consumption. Cefadroxil is often clinically recognized for its ability to achieve efficacy with a less frequent dosing schedule, which is a practical factor in supporting patient adherence to therapy.


How Does Cefadroxil Generally Help Treat Infections?

The general purpose of Cefadroxil is to act as a bactericidal agent, meaning it exerts its effect by directly killing the susceptible bacteria that cause an infection. Its mode of action involves interfering with the vital process of bacterial cell wall synthesis. By disrupting the formation and structural integrity of this outer layer—a necessary component for bacterial survival—the medication eliminates the underlying pathogen, leading to the resolution of the bacterial illness.

What side effects are possible with Ancefa?

Possible Side Effects and Safety Information

The safety profile of Ancefa (Cefadroxil) is based on data formally documented by government regulatory agencies, detailing adverse reactions by affected system and frequency.

Frequency-Classified Adverse Reactions

Adverse reactions are organized according to frequency bands established in official regulatory documents:

  • Common (1% to 10%): Includes gastrointestinal effects (diarrhea, nausea, vomiting, dyspepsia, abdominal pain) and skin/dermatological reactions (rash, pruritus, urticaria).
  • Uncommon (0.1% to 1%): Primarily involves superinfections, such as vaginal mycoses (thrush) due to the overgrowth of non-susceptible organisms.
  • Rare/Very Rare (< 0.1%): Involves events like Angioedema, Agranulocytosis (a blood disorder), and significant increases in liver enzymes.

Serious Adverse Reactions and Safety Constraints

Regulatory sources explicitly document certain severe, though infrequent, risks:

Category Documented Serious Reaction/Constraint
Severe Allergic Reactions Anaphylactic Shock, Stevens-Johnson Syndrome (SJS), and Toxic Epidermal Necrolysis (TEN).
Gastrointestinal Risk Clostridium difficile-associated diarrhea (CDAD), which can range to fatal colitis.
Blood/Organ Risk Hemolytic Anemia and nephrotoxicity (kidney damage).

Population and Duration Notes

The medicine is contraindicated in individuals with a known allergy to Cefadroxil or the cephalosporin class of antibiotics. Caution is required for patients with impaired renal function due to the risk of accumulation. Patients with a history of penicillin allergy should be prescribed Cefadroxil with caution due to the documented potential for cross-sensitivity. Prolonged use may result in the risk of superinfection.

Eligibility and Restrictions for Use

Who Can and Cannot Use Ancefa? (Cefadroxil)

The population eligibility for using Ancefa (Cefadroxil) is strictly defined by regulatory documents, focusing on hypersensitivity, organ function, and specific life stages.

Eligibility Status Defined Population Condition/Restriction
Contraindicated Patients with a known allergy to the cephalosporin group of antibiotics Absolute non-eligibility
Restricted Use Patients with a history of severe reactions to penicillins or other beta-lactam drugs Use requires extreme caution due to documented cross-sensitivity risks
Conditional Use Individuals with markedly impaired renal function (creatinine clearance < 50 mL/min/1.73 m^2 or less) Requires caution and monitoring; dosage adjustment is mandated
Age-Group Eligibility Adults and Children (beyond the neonatal period) Use is established; older adults require caution due to potential age-related kidney decline
Reproductive Status Pregnancy (Category B) and Lactation (Nursing Mothers) Should be used during pregnancy only if clearly needed; caution is advised for nursing mothers

Eligibility is further restricted for individuals with a history of gastrointestinal disease, particularly colitis, where the drug must be prescribed with caution. Use in the absence of a proven or strongly suspected bacterial infection is officially discouraged by regulatory bodies.

What should I know about interactions with other medicines?

Ancefa Interactions with Other Medicines and Products

Interactions involving Ancefa (Cefadroxil) are officially documented by regulatory authorities, focusing on changes in drug exposure, pharmacodynamic effects, and diagnostic test interference.

Documented Pharmacokinetic Interactions

Co-administration with the gout medication Probenecid is known to significantly alter the clearance of Cefadroxil. Probenecid inhibits the renal tubular secretion of Cefadroxil, which results in increased plasma concentrations of the antibiotic. This interaction is particularly relevant for individuals with impaired renal function, where Cefadroxil elimination is already reduced.


Documented Pharmacodynamic Interactions

Official labeling identifies two key areas of concern regarding combined use with other medications:

  • Antagonistic Effects: Combining Cefadroxil with bacteriostatic antibiotics, such as tetracycline or chloramphenicol, is discouraged due to the documented possibility of an antagonistic effect on Cefadroxil's action.
  • Potentiated Toxicity: Co-administration with known nephrotoxic agents, including aminoglycoside antibiotics, polymyxin B, and high-dose loop diuretics (like Furosemide), should be avoided as the combination can potentiate nephrotoxic effects.

Interactions with Products and Laboratory Tests

Cefadroxil is documented to interfere with certain diagnostic procedures, potentially leading to inaccurate results:

  • Urine Glucose Tests: A false positive reaction for glucose may occur when using non-enzyme-based copper sulfate solutions (e.g., Clinitest tablets).
  • Coombs' Test: Treatment with Cefadroxil can result in a Positive direct Coombs' test.

Mechanism of Action

Mechanism of Action

Ancefa functions by targeting the final stages of bacterial cell wall biosynthesis. Its primary action is the irreversible inhibition of specific Penicillin-Binding Proteins (PBPs), which act as transpeptidases essential for cross-linking the peptidoglycan structure. This targeted molecular inhibition blocks the crucial structural stabilization of the bacterial cell wall.

This disruption initiates a lethal cascade: the compromised cell wall structure is unable to withstand the organism's high internal osmotic pressure, which, combined with the activation of bacterial autolytic enzymes, causes the cell membrane to rupture (lysis). This sequence of events results in the rapid bactericidal effect against susceptible bacterial cells.

The mechanism is defined by its selectivity, acting exclusively on the peptidoglycan structure absent in host cells. However, its mechanistic integrity is constrained by the presence of bacterial boldsymbolbeta-lactamase enzymes, which chemically inactivate the drug and constrain its capacity to disrupt the cell wall of resistant strains.

Dosage and Administration Information

How Ancefa is Used: Official Administration Guidelines

Ancefa (Cefadroxil) is a prescription antibiotic administered exclusively via the oral route. The official instructions for its use are defined by regulatory agencies, detailing the specific forms, dosing frequency, and administration conditions.


Administration and Dosage Forms

Feature Official Labeled Instructions
Route of Administration Oral use only.
Available Forms Capsules (500 mg), Tablets (1 g), and Powder for Oral Suspension (125 mg/5 mL, 250 mg/5 mL, 500 mg/5 mL).
Intake with Food May be taken without regard to meals; however, taking it with food may help minimize potential gastrointestinal discomfort.

Standard Dosing and Duration

Standard adult dosing is typically 1 gram per day, though 2 grams per day may be used for certain complex urinary tract infections. The frequency of administration is either once a day (q.d.) or in two equally divided doses (b.i.d.) depending on the specific infection being treated.

The official duration of use requires that treatment for infections caused by Group A beta-hemolytic Streptococci (e.g., pharyngitis) be maintained for a minimum of 10 days. Patients are instructed to complete the full prescribed course of therapy.

Population-Specific Use Rules

Pediatric Dosing: For children, the dose is generally calculated based on body weight, typically 30 mg/kg/day in single or divided doses.

Renal Impairment: Dosing must be adjusted (reduced and/or interval prolonged) for patients with compromised kidney function (creatinine clearance leq 50 mL/min), as specified in the official label.

Recent Clinical Evidence

Research Evidence / Overview of Studies for Ancefa (Cefadroxil)


Evidence for Use in Uncomplicated Urinary Tract Infections (UTI)

Research exploring the effects of Cefadroxil for uncomplicated infections of the urinary tract (UTI) primarily relies on randomized controlled trials (RCTs) and controlled comparison studies. The research examined outcomes related to systemic or functional imbalance, specifically measuring whether the infecting bacteria were eliminated (microbiological cure) and how patient-reported outcomes changed during the study period. Studies monitored both short-term clearance of the pathogen and the change in patient discomfort after a typical course. Studies monitored microbiological cure rates, and findings describe patterns observed in these studies. Contemporary comparative evidence is often lacking, meaning data on how Cefadroxil compares to the newest agents in the context of current antibiotic resistance patterns are not widely established.


Evidence for Use in Skin and Skin Structure Infections (SSSI)

Research exploring Cefadroxil's use in SSSI has utilized randomized, controlled trials and controlled clinical success studies. The included populations cover adults and children with localized, uncomplicated infections such as impetigo and cellulitis. Research examined outcomes related to physical discomfort, focusing on how lesions and symptoms changed and whether the harmful bacteria were eradicated. Studies report patterns observed in the groups studied regarding clinical success, which was measured by criteria defining "cure" or "improvement" of the skin condition. The reported outcomes were primarily short-term and based on defined time intervals. The existing studies provide limited insight into the course of severe or deep-seated SSSI, as the focus was predominantly on uncomplicated infections.


Durability of Response and Research Gaps

Research for Cefadroxil predominantly focuses on short-term symptom changes and episodic outcomes, aligning with the acute nature of the infections studied. The follow-up durations were limited in most key trials, often extending only 2 to 4 weeks after the last dose of the medication. The research does not widely include patients with significant comorbid conditions or infections deemed complicated in controlled trials. Furthermore, official research summaries often note that there are few data available specifically addressing its inclusion in older adults as a defined subgroup, or in pregnant populations.

Frequently Asked Questions (FAQ)

Common questions about Ancefa (FAQ)

Q: Does Ancefa interact with common over-the-counter pain relievers?

A: Official labeling requires caution when taking Ancefa with certain medications that can affect the kidneys (nephrotoxic agents). However, common non-prescription pain relievers, such as acetaminophen or ibuprofen, are not listed as a specific, known interaction in the drug's official product information that requires an explicit warning or adjustment.

Q: What's the difference between Ancefa and other cephalosporin antibiotics?

A: Ancefa (Cefadroxil) is classified as a first-generation cephalosporin antibiotic. This classification generally means it has high activity against specific Gram-positive bacteria, such as Staphylococcus and Streptococcus. Later generations of cephalosporins are typically developed to target a different, often broader, range of bacteria.

Q: How long does Ancefa stay in your system?

A: In adults with normal kidney function, Ancefa (Cefadroxil) has a relatively short half-life, meaning the body eliminates the drug quickly. Official pharmacokinetic data indicate that over 90% of the unchanged drug is typically excreted in the urine within 24 hours of administration.

Q: Are there any specific foods or drinks to avoid while using Ancefa?

A: Official drug information states that Ancefa may be taken with or without food. Taking it with food may help minimize any potential stomach discomfort. No specific foods or drinks are formally listed in regulatory documents as needing to be avoided while using this medication.

Q: Does Ancefa affect birth control pills?

A: Official drug interaction summaries for Ancefa (Cefadroxil) generally do not list a major, established interaction with oral contraceptives (birth control pills). The official label focuses on interactions with other drug classes, such as Probenecid and nephrotoxic agents.

Q: How quickly does Ancefa typically start working?

A: Ancefa is a bactericidal agent, meaning its chemical mechanism of action starts immediately upon administration to kill susceptible bacteria. Patients often observe an improvement in their infection symptoms within the first few days of starting the prescribed treatment course.

Q: What kind of infections does Ancefa target?

A: Ancefa (Cefadroxil) is indicated for treating bacterial infections in specific areas of the body. These indications include infections of the skin and skin structure, the urinary tract, and the upper respiratory tract (such as tonsillitis or pharyngitis caused by susceptible bacteria).

Q: Is Ancefa ever used for skin infections?

A: Yes, Ancefa (Cefadroxil) is indicated for the treatment of skin and skin structure infections (SSSI). Regulatory research overviews confirm that studies have supported its use for specific, uncomplicated infections like impetigo and cellulitis.

Q: What happens if I miss a dose of Ancefa (in a hospital setting)?

A: Official guidance regarding a missed dose indicates that if it is remembered soon after, it should be taken. If it is almost time for the next scheduled dose, the missed dose should be skipped entirely. It is crucial to continue with the regular schedule and avoid taking a double dose.

Q: Can Ancefa cause an allergic reaction, and what are the signs?

A: Yes, Cefadroxil can cause allergic reactions. Signs of less severe reactions documented in the official safety information can include skin changes like a rash, itching (pruritus), or hives (urticaria). More severe, although rare, allergic reactions are also possible.

Q: Is Ancefa safe to use during pregnancy (general information)?

A: Ancefa is classified as Pregnancy Category B. This means that animal studies have not demonstrated a risk to the fetus. However, it is used during pregnancy only after a healthcare provider determines that the potential benefit is judged to outweigh the potential risk.

Q: Can seniors or older adults use Ancefa?

A: Use in older adults is generally established. However, because seniors are more likely to have natural age-related decreases in kidney function, regulatory guidance states that caution and dose adjustments may be required in those with impaired renal clearance.

Q: What research is available on the long-term effects of Ancefa?

A: The research supporting Ancefa's main uses primarily focuses on short-term outcomes that align with acute infection treatment. The key clinical trials generally had limited follow-up durations (often only a few weeks), meaning extensive data on the chronic or long-term effects of the medication are not widely available.

Q: Why do some people experience diarrhea when using Ancefa?

A: Diarrhea is listed as a common side effect in the product's safety information. Antibiotics, including Ancefa, can sometimes disrupt the normal balance of microorganisms in the gut. In rare cases, this imbalance can lead to a serious condition known as Clostridium difficile-associated diarrhea (CDAD).

Q: Does Ancefa interact with common cold or flu medications?

A: Ancefa is designed to treat only bacterial infections and is not effective against viral illnesses like the common cold or flu. While general cold medications are not universally listed as an interaction, the official labeling warns against use with other drugs known to have nephrotoxic (kidney-damaging) properties.

Q: Are there studies supporting the use of Ancefa in specific patient groups?

A: Research overviews indicate that controlled trials for Ancefa often focused on patients with uncomplicated infections and may have excluded individuals with significant co-morbid conditions. Consequently, data on its use in specific, complex patient subgroups may be limited.

Q: What types of bacteria is Ancefa effective against?

A: Official microbiology sections confirm that Ancefa is effective against certain susceptible Gram-positive organisms (such as Staphylococcus and Streptococcus species) and some common Gram-negative organisms (such as Escherichia coli), which are often the cause of the indicated infections.

Q: Can Ancefa cause changes in blood sugar levels?

A: Ancefa can cause a false positive result for glucose (sugar) when specific non-enzyme-based urine tests are used. For individuals monitoring their sugar intake, it is also noted in regulatory information that the oral liquid suspension formulation contains sucrose.

Q: How do you know if Ancefa is working to clear an infection?

A: Ancefa is intended to kill the bacteria causing the infection. Signs that the medication may be effective often include an improvement in symptoms, such as a reduction in fever, pain, redness, or inflammation, typically observed within the first few days of treatment.

Q: Are there generic versions of Ancefa available?

A: Yes. The active ingredient in Ancefa is Cefadroxil, which is widely available from various manufacturers as a generic drug. This is permitted because the FDA has confirmed the original brand-name product was not withdrawn due to safety or effectiveness reasons.

Q: Does Ancefa interact with medications for high blood pressure?

A: The official label does not list common high blood pressure medications as a specific, known interaction. However, caution is advised if combining Ancefa with high-dose loop diuretics (which are sometimes used to manage blood pressure) due to the documented risk of potentiated nephrotoxicity (kidney damage).

Q: Is Ancefa used in veterinary medicine?

A: Yes, regulatory listings, such as the FDA Green Book, indicate that Cefadroxil (the active ingredient) is also an approved drug product for use in veterinary medicine.

Q: How does Ancefa differ from ampicillin?

A: Ancefa (Cefadroxil) is classified as a cephalosporin antibiotic, whereas ampicillin is classified as a penicillin antibiotic. While both belong to the beta-lactam family, they are from different classes and may have differing spectra of activity and susceptibility to bacterial resistance.

How should Ancefa be stored and disposed of?

The storage and disposal of Ancefa (Cefadroxil) are strictly defined by regulatory requirements based on the medicine's form.

Storage Conditions

Form Temperature Requirement Protection / Container Rule
Capsules/Tablets/Powder Controlled Room Temperature (20°C to 25°C) Keep in a tightly closed container, away from excess heat and moisture.
Reconstituted Suspension Store in a refrigerator (2°C to 8°C). Do not freeze. Discard any unused portion after 14 days.

All forms of this medication must be stored in a safe location, out of the reach of children. Unused or expired Cefadroxil should be disposed of according to official local and national regulations. When a drug take-back program is unavailable, official guidance recommends mixing the medicine with an undesirable substance and discarding it in the trash, avoiding release to the environment.
